After 24 years of travelling, Marco Polo returned home to find Venice at war with Genoa. He joined the war, but his ship was captured and he was imprisoned. While in prison, Marco dictated his stories to his cellmate who, as the Twelfth Doctor noted, embellished and added some of his own stuff.
